Hi, We have a query that we can resolve using either facet or search with rollup. In the Stream Source Reference section of Solr’s Reference Guide (https://lucene.apache.org/solr/guide/7_1/stream-source-reference.html#facet) it says “To support high cardinality aggregations see the rollup function”. I was wondering what it’s considered “high cardinality”. If it serves, our query returns up to 60k results. I haven’t got to do any benchmarking to see if there’s any difference, though, because facet so far performs very well, but I don’t know if I’m near the “tipping point”.
